Due to prolonged heavy rain and strong water flow from upstream, in recent days, many land positions on the banks of Ngan Mo River through Cam Due commune (Cam Xuyen, Ha Tinh ) have been eroded, threatening people's houses.
Cam Due commune mobilized vehicles and human resources to reinforce landslides in Phuong Tru village.
Landslides appeared in the villages of Trung Thanh, Tran Phu, and Phuong Tru. The most serious landslide was in Phuong Tru village; some landslides were about 200m long, eating deep into the garden area and causing landslides in the outbuildings of Mr. Cao Van Trinh's family (Phuong Tru village, Cam Due commune).
Faced with a serious landslide, this morning (October 14), the People's Committee of Cam Due commune mobilized more than 200 people from the police, militia and local organizations to reinforce the landslide at Mr. Cao Van Trinh's house.
People transported nearly 100 blocks of rubble, 50 steel nets and a series of bamboo stakes of various types... to reinforce and repair the eroded riverbank areas.
More than 200 people were mobilized to carry out landslide reinforcement work.
It is expected that this afternoon (October 14), local authorities will complete the work of reinforcing the landslide site in Phuong Tru village.
The immediate reinforcement is to prevent the risk of riverbank erosion spreading and eating deep into residential areas; in the long term, the local government will propose to higher levels and relevant agencies to research and have solutions to thoroughly handle and overcome the erosion, including investing funds to build a solid concrete embankment.
